Nestled behind the impressive Town Hall of La Orotava lies the beautiful Hijuela del Botánico, a public garden that is an oasis of tranquility and a significant piece of history. Covering an area of 3,390 square meters, this botanical haven offers visitors a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of Tenerife.

History of Hijuela del Botánico

The origins of the Hijuela can be traced back to the 18th century, under the reign of Carlos III. In 1788, the VI Marquis of Villanueva del Prado, Alonso de Nava y Grimón, envisioned this garden as a complement to the nearby Jardín de Aclimatación de la Orotava. Interestingly, the garden was established on the grounds of the former San José Convent, which housed Clarisas nuns from 1601 until its demolition in 1868.

A Glimpse of Architectural Splendor

The architectural significance of the Hijuela del Botánico cannot be overstated. The arrival of the new Town Hall in 1888 shaped the landscape around this charming garden, while an eclectic iron gate graces its perimeter, enhancing its historical grandeur. The gate, featuring delicate plant motifs, invites visitors to explore the rich plant collections and serene surroundings.

Botanical Collections and Flora

The charm of the Hijuela isn’t merely in its history but also in its diverse botanical collections that include:

  • Palms
  • Bromeliaceae species
  • Araceae family
  • Moraceae varieties

Among the unique specimens are:

  • Metasequoia glyptostroboides (Dawn Redwood)
  • Dracaena draco (Dragon Tree)
  • Arbutus canariensis (Canary Strawberry Tree)
  • Ginkgo biloba (Ginkgo)

These trees, some ancient and rare, offer a unique opportunity for garden enthusiasts and cultural explorers alike to experience the natural beauty and diversity of the Canary Islands.

A Scientific Approach to Conservation

Beyond its picturesque setting, Hijuela del Botánico also serves a vital role as a scientific institution. It engages in:

  • International germplasm exchange programs
  • Maintenance of a herbarium dedicated to the flora of the Canary Islands

This commitment to scientific discovery and conservation addresses the need for preserving cultural heritage and biodiversity, making the garden not just a tourist attraction, but a center for ecological awareness.
